> > Actually, what we released with 3.0.2 does not seem to compile on Qt 4.2,
> > but it does compile on 4.3.4, so I will be changing the documentation to
> > require at least 4.3.

> > If you want a version that *does* work with bat,
> > download the package in the depkgs-qt area (depkgs-qt-28Jul09.tar.gz).
> > When you detar it, do the following:
> >
> > cd depkgs-qt
> > make qt4
> >
> > then when you build Bacula, either source the qt4-paths file in depkgs-qt
> > or execute them directly before building, and eliminate any code in the
> > .spec file that resets the QTxxx environment variables.  With that, you
> > should be able to build most distributions with Bat -- providing you want
> > to.
